The Role of Heat Shields in Modern Vehicles
Heat shields serve a vital purpose in automotive engineering. Their primary function is to protect various components from the intense heat produced by the engine and exhaust systems. By insulating sensitive parts, heat shields enhance vehicle safety and reliability.
Key Benefits of Automotive Heat Shields
- Improved Safety: Heat shields help prevent heat-related damages that could lead to fires or other hazardous situations.
- Increased Efficiency: By reflecting heat away from critical components, these shields improve overall vehicle performance.
- Noise Reduction: They also serve to dampen noise from the engine, enhancing cabin comfort.
Emerging Trends Influencing Heat Shield Innovation
As technology advances, so does the design and functionality of automotive heat shields. Here are some trends currently influencing the market:
1. Lightweight Materials
With a growing emphasis on fuel efficiency and performance, manufacturers are exploring lightweight materials for heat shield production. Utilizing materials such as aluminum or advanced composites can reduce vehicular weight without compromising effectiveness.
2. Enhanced Thermal Management Systems
The integration of advanced thermal management systems is becoming increasingly common. These systems optimize heat shield performance, allowing vehicles to operate at peak efficiency even under extreme conditions.
3. Customization and Flexibility
As vehicles become more personalized, heat shields are also being designed with customization in mind. Manufacturers now offer tailored solutions to fit specific vehicle models, enhancing both aesthetic and functional appeal.
Market Dynamics and Future Outlook
The automotive heat shield market is witnessing significant growth, driven by innovations and a rising awareness about safety. Key dynamics include:
1. Increased Regulatory Standards
Government regulations regarding vehicle safety and emissions are pushing manufacturers to invest in advanced heat shield technologies. Compliance with these standards is crucial for market success.
2. Rising Demand for Electric Vehicles (EVs)
The surge in electric vehicle production presents new challenges and opportunities. Heat shields in EVs require different designs to accommodate unique thermal dynamics, prompting manufacturers to adapt their approaches.
3. Global Supply Chain Changes
Recent global events have disrupted supply chains, compelling manufacturers to rethink sourcing strategies. Ensuring a reliable supply of materials for heat shield production is becoming more critical than ever.
